Dubbed as the DNA of Cognac, Henri IV Dudognon Heritage is presented in an exquisite bottle.

Produced since 1776 it is aged in barrels for more than 100 years. Exorbitantly priced at 1 Million Pounds Sterling, the liquor is bottled in a bottle dipped in 24 K Yellow Gold & Sterling Platinum and decorated with 6,500 certified brilliant cut diamonds. With an approximate weight of 8 Kilograms, it is filled with 100 cl. of Dudognon Heritage Cognac Grande Champagne that contains an alcohol content of 41%.

This jewelled packing was master crafted by the well known jeweller Jose Davalos
